About This Item

Harry N. Abrams. Used - Very Good. 1973. Cloth, dj. Folio. 240 pp. 157 illustrations, 136 in color. Mild shelf wear to dust jacket. Previous owner's inscription to ffep. Altogether a copy in Very Good condition. (Subject: Southeast Asia.)
